To celebrate the 50th anniversary of the Beatles first appearance on the Ed Sullivan show Apple have added a “Beatles” channel to your Apple TV as of today. Inside that channel is a chance to watch some amazing footage as well as buy and listen to all the Beatles catalogue of music
Sitting alongside apps (or channels – depending on who you talk to) like NBA, NHL, Red Bull TV, Crackle and more “The Beatles” stands out as an icon on the refreshed Apple TV home screen with a distinctive black and white image of the “Fab Four” performing on the Ed Sullivan show.
Launch into the channel and you’ll find a clear 50th branding on the page along with a single item to play which is a 15 minute stream of black and white footage from the Beatles very first appearance on the Ed Sullivan Show.
Originally split into two parts, the segments have been joined into one segment for easy viewing. In total you’ll hear five great classic tracks

The crowd goes wild and Ed Sullivan takes the time to thank the New York Police Department for their help with what must have been a crowd control nightmare.
If you have Apple TV all you need to do is turn it on and the channel will appear, on the second row of icons. Additionally you will see “iTunes Radio” appear next to “Music” and if you love your Beatles music there’s a Beatles radio station to listen to – but be warned, its more covers of Beatles songs than Beatles originals.
